In The Court of Appeals For The First District of Texas ———————————— NO. 01-19-00679-CV ——————————— GUS H. (TREY) COMISKEY, III, Appellant V. H. DAVID RAMM, WATERSIDE CONSTRUCTION LLC, AND WSD CONSTRUCTION, LLC, Appellees
On Appeal from the 190th District Court Harris County, Texas Trial Court Case No. 2017-00507
MEMORANDUM OPINION Appellant, Gus H. (Trey) Comiskey, III, has neither paid the required fees nor established indigence for purposes of appellate costs. See TEX. R. APP. P. 5, 20.1; see also TEX. GOV’T CODE §§ 51.207, 51.208, 51.941(a), 101.041; Order, Fees Charged in the Supreme Court, in Civil Cases in the Courts of Appeals, and Before the Judicial Panel on Multi-District Litigation, Misc. Docket No. 15-9158 (Tex. Aug.
28, 2015). After being notified that this appeal was subject to dismissal, appellant did not adequately respond. See TEX. R. APP. P. 5, 42.3(b), (c).
We dismiss the appeal for want of prosecution for nonpayment of all required fees. See TEX. R. APP. P. 42.3(b), (c), 43.2(f). We dismiss any pending motions as moot.
PER CURIAM Panel consists of Justices Keyes, Goodman, and Countiss.
